Obituary of Esther L. Rogers March 27, 2014 Esther L. Rogers, 97, of Fulton, passed away surrounded by her family on Thursday, March 27 at Michaud Residential Health Services in Fulton. Born in Canastota, Esther lived in Oneida before moving to Fulton in 1961. She co-owned Lower Falls Liquor Store in Fulton with her husband, Harley, in the 1960’s. She was predeceased by her husband, Harley F. Rogers in 1992 and by a sister, Doris Wishart and two brothers, Richard Wishart and Leon Reising. Surviving are: a son, Harley “Tom” (Sue) Rogers of Leoma, TN; two daughters, Peggy (Bob) Cushman of Oneida and Debbie (Paul) Foster of Fulton; a brother, Don Reising of Blossvale; nine grandchildren, Mike (Diane) Cushman, Sue (Frederick) Stefanik, Valerie (Beth Curry) Cushman, Tim (Tina) Cushman, Chris Cushman, Kim (Neil) DiSpirito, Karen Vanderwalker, Kim (Kelly) Leroux and Dennis (Brea) Goss; 19 great-grandchildren; three great-great-grandchildren; nieces, nephews and cousins.
